Abstract
Case: A 58 years old Caucasian female with past medical history of morbid obesity presented to her local gastroenterologist with a complaint of dysphagia. She underwent upper endoscopy that revealed a subepithelial lesion in mid esophagus. The EGD was otherwise unremarkable. She was referred to our service for endoscopic ultrasound evaluation.
